In the world of poker, Indian Poker stands out as a unique and intriguing variation. Unlike traditional games like Texas Hold'em or Omaha, Indian Poker relies heavily on psychological skills to assess one's standing in the game.
Each player is dealt one card face down and places it on their forehead, making the visible cards a crucial element in the game. This setup, reminiscent of a Native American headdress, is believed to be the origin of the game's name, "Indian Poker."
Indian Poker is not just about the cards; it's a game of strategy, bluff, and observation. Observing opponents' behavior, bluffing smartly, managing your bankroll, understanding betting patterns, and knowing when to fold are key strategies to win at Indian Poker.
However, it's essential to be aware of common pitfalls. Not folding at the right time can result in unnecessary losses, as can bluffing excessively, making your strategy predictable. Overestimating your hand is a common mistake for beginners, while ignoring betting patterns can lead to poor decision-making.
In some variations of Indian Poker, such as the Muflis (Lowball Indian Poker), the player with the lowest card wins instead of the highest. In Joker-Enabled Indian Poker, the deck includes jokers, which serve as wild cards and can replace any other card. The AK47 Variation introduces cards A, K, 4, and 7 as wild cards, adding another layer of complexity.
